2002 Kia Sorento vs. 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ight

To start off, 2002 Kia Sorento is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ight would be higher. At 3,491 cc (6 cylinders), 2002 Kia Sorento is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Kia Sorento (192 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 84 more horse power than 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ight. (108 HP @ 4800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2002 Kia Sorento should accelerate faster than 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 Kia Sorento weights approximately 530 kg more than 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2002 Kia Sorento is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2002 Kia Sorento will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 Kia Sorento (301 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 105 more torque (in Nm) than 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ight. (196 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2002 Kia Sorento will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ight.

Compare all specifications:

2002 Kia Sorento 1985 Oldsmobile Ninety-Eight
Make Kia Oldsmobile
Model Sorento Ninety-Eight
Year Released 2002 1985
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3491 cc 2966 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Horse Power 192 HP 108 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 4800 RPM
Torque 301 Nm 196 Nm
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 2400 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Front
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Vehicle Weight 1990 kg 1460 kg
Vehicle Length 4500 mm 5010 mm
Vehicle Width 1840 mm 1850 mm
Vehicle Height 1710 mm 1410 mm
Wheelbase Size 2670 mm 2830 mm
